Depositor

Pronunciation: /dəˈpɑːzɪtər/

Depositor (noun)

  1. A person who puts money into a bank account.
  2. A person who gives money to another party to keep safely until a later time.
  3. A person who hands over an item to be stored or held by an organization.

Examples

  • The depositor checks the balance every week.
  • The bank contacts the depositor about the account.
